Job Responsibility

  • Coordinate the Machines and Automation efforts on new program launches
  • Set up and/or revise manufacturing processes for current programs
  • Assist manufacturing operations in problem solving and continuous process improvements: Reduced Scrap, Increase OE, Reduced Cycle Time
  • Document and present findings of improvements to management
  • Implement improvements at the floor
  • Lead Automation process through support manufacturing Operations
  • Oversee tooling, fixture, and gauge design and engineering drawing mark-ups per job launch plans
  • Program existing equipment, assist in defect reductions, and improve OEE
  • Support existing manufacturing lines in production
  • Optimize/setup programs to improve equipment efficiencies and output
  • Develop, evaluate, and improve the manufacturing process and reduce downtime through creation of known good conditions, and improving change-over methods
  • Reduce cycle time and provide training necessary to meet KPI targets
  • Support the cross functional team as needed
  • Maintain and write work instructions, control plans, process flow, and process failure modes effects analysis documents
  • Administer and ensure compliance with current safety policies
  • Maintain accurate records of rework performed and communicate status to supervisors or quality teams
  • Design electrical and pneumatic controls designs utilizing AutoCAD Electrical for drawing development
  • Develop a bill of controls materials, seeking cost estimates for purchasing department – work with management to get parts ordered on time
  • Design the interconnections of peripheral hardware
  • Develop the system software architecture
  • Write the control system software
  • Develop Human to Machine Interface (HMI) programs and integrate with the control system
  • Integrate and/or program peripheral hardware and software
  • Debug the system hardware and software
  • Run factory acceptance test at supplier and facility
  • Support the installation of the equipment
  • Adhere to established control standards and procedures
  • Observe safety procedures

Requirements

  • Bachelor of Engineering OR in lieu of a Bachelors’ degree, a High School Diploma AND 8 + years’ experience as a Control Automation Engineer in automotive electrical center plant.
  • PLC's, HMI’s and Motion Control
  • Allen Bradley – Studio 5000
  • Siemens – TIA Portal
  • Omron – Sysmac Studio
  • Robots (Epson, Fanuc)
  • Vision System (Cognex, Keyence, Matrox)
  • Industrial Protocols (Ethernet IP, Ethernet TCP/IP, Profinet, EtherCat)
  • SQL Database integration for product traceability
  • AutoCAD Electrical - design
  • Visual Studio Programming
  • Lean Manufacturing
  • Knowledge of APQP quality principles
  • TS-16949 IATF
